International version of the hardcore rap act's 1993 debut album 'Enter The Wu-Tang (36 Chambers)'. Includes one bonus track, 'Method Man (Remix) Skunk Mix'. 13 tracks in all. 2000 release. Standard jewelcase.

This is the return of Wu-Tang! Their first studio release since the death of Dirty Ol Bastard; these superstars have returned...GZA, RZA, Method Man, Ghostface Killa, Raekwon, U-God, Inspecta Deck and Masta Killa, they're all here. "The Hear Gently Weeps" features Erykah Badu and is the first song to feature a Beatles sample! This is A MUST for true hip-hop fans. "The 8 Diagrams" comes with a bonus DVD!!

2010 release, a collection of various Wu-Tang Clan songs and unreleased Wu-Tang remixes all produced by Mathematics. Born and raised in Jamaica, Queens, South Side, Mathematics began his career in 1987 by DJing block parties and throwing his own park jams in Baisley Projects. In 1990, Mathematics linked up with The Genius, AKA GZA. Soon after, RZA asked Math to design a logo for the up and coming crew (Math was a graffiti artist as well), and his resulting design is now instantly recognized worldwide. Return Of The Wu features vocals from the entire Clan including Ghostface, Raekwon, RZA, GZA, ODB, Method Man, Masta Killa, Inspectah Deck and U-God. Six unreleased exclusive remixes by DJ Mathematics are featured on the album.
